Lufthansa has applied “Fanhansa” titles to the pictured Airbus A321neo registered as D-AIEH.

This aircraft is supposed to be a transport aircraft assigned to the upcoming European World Cup, but there has not been any official announcement from the airline.

The European Championship 2024 commences on June 14 in Munich with a match between Germany and Scotland.
